Эх сурвалжийг харах

Fixed NS_ASSUME_NONNULL_BEGIN not located at the right place in GCDWebServerPrivate.h

Pierre-Olivier Latour 7 жил өмнө
parent
commit
06569fe2cc

+ 3 - 3
GCDWebServer/Core/GCDWebServerPrivate.h

@@ -48,8 +48,6 @@
 #import "GCDWebServerFileResponse.h"
 #import "GCDWebServerStreamedResponse.h"
 
-NS_ASSUME_NONNULL_BEGIN
-
 /**
  *  Check if a custom logging facility should be used instead.
  */
@@ -101,7 +99,7 @@ typedef NS_ENUM(int, GCDWebServerLoggingLevel) {
 };
 
 extern GCDWebServerLoggingLevel GCDWebServerLogLevel;
-extern void GCDWebServerLogMessage(GCDWebServerLoggingLevel level, NSString* format, ...) NS_FORMAT_FUNCTION(2, 3);
+extern void GCDWebServerLogMessage(GCDWebServerLoggingLevel level, NSString* _Nonnull format, ...) NS_FORMAT_FUNCTION(2, 3);
 
 #if DEBUG
 #define GWS_LOG_DEBUG(...)                                                                                                             \
@@ -155,6 +153,8 @@ extern void GCDWebServerLogMessage(GCDWebServerLoggingLevel level, NSString* for
 
 #endif
 
+NS_ASSUME_NONNULL_BEGIN
+
 /**
  *  GCDWebServer internal constants and APIs.
  */